Karyanti revealed that severe abdominal pain and any bleeding that occurs in children can be a sign of further danger of dengue fever. “Any bleeding, on the skin, nosebleeds, bleeding gums. Immediately take them to the hospital. Or if the child is restless, his hands and feet feel cold,” said Karyanti. On the same occasion, … Read more

Denpasar – Denpasar City Health Office (Dinkes) will apply wolbachia technology in 2023 to reduce cases of dengue hemorrhagic fever (DHF). This technique has previously been tested in Klaten, Central Java, and succeeded in reducing cases by up to 77 percent. “We hope that with Wolbachia cases in Denpasar will also decrease,” said the Head … Read more

Madiun (ANTARA) – The Madiun City Office of Health, Population Control and Family Planning reported 209 cases of dengue fever from January to December 2022 in the local area. “As of the end of this year, there were 209 cases of dengue fever, of which two cases died,” said the head of the Madiun City … Read more
